Its main feature is a 50 MP rear camera, complete with Optical Image Stabilization (OIS) and a Sony IMX890 sensor, designed to minimize blur from minor hand movements and capture detailed, vibrant images.

Complementing the primary sensor are two additional lenses of 8MP and 2MP, providing the versatility to capture wide-angle shots and add depth-of-field effects to your photos.

A key highlight of the NARZO 70 Pro 5G's camera system is its remarkable low-light performance, facilitated by a large sensor and sophisticated image processing algorithms, making it an excellent choice for night or indoor photography.
